The Global Smart Meter Market has been experiencing significant growth over the past few years. As of 2025, the global market is valued at approximately $22 billion. Further, the Global Market is projected to expand at a CAGR of 9.8% from 2025 to 2031. Additionally, by 2031, the market size is expected to reach around $43 billion.

Data privacy and security concerns are at the forefront, as smart meters collect and transmit detailed information about energy usage patterns, raising issues about unauthorized access and data breaches. The high initial costs associated with the installation and maintenance of smart meters pose a financial challenge, particularly for small- to medium-sized utilities. Compatibility issues and the need for adequate infrastructure to support smart metering systems can also impede market growth. Moreover, consumer awareness and acceptance remain challenges, as some users may be resistant to adopting new technologies due to a lack of understanding of the benefits or mistrust in the systems' reliability.

According to Ravi Bhandari, Research Head, 6wresearch, the electric smart meter market is experiencing significant growth as energy industries worldwide shift towards smarter, more efficient grid systems. Electric smart meters offer the advantage of real-time monitoring of electricity consumption, empowering consumers to manage their energy use more effectively. Additionally, these devices support utility companies by providing accurate data collection, which enhances billing accuracy and reduces operational costs. As technology advances, smart meters are becoming even more sophisticated, incorporating features like two-way communication, which facilitates immediate connectivity between consumers and energy providers.
The integration of RF (Radio Frequency) technology in the smart meter market has been transformative, enhancing the efficiency and accuracy of energy consumption data collection. RF communication allows smart meters to wirelessly transmit real-time data to utility companies, eliminating the need for manual meter readings. This not only reduces operational costs but also provides consumers with detailed insights into their energy usage patterns. Moreover, RF technology supports advanced functionalities such as outage detection and remote service disconnects.
The software in the smart meter market plays a critical role in managing and analyzing energy consumption data. Advanced metering infrastructure (AMI) software enables utilities to utilize real-time data for more efficient energy distribution and load balancing. This software facilitates remote monitoring and metering, enhances billing accuracy, and supports demand response programs, leading to more sustainable energy practices. Moreover, the integration of smart meter software with artificial intelligence and machine learning algorithms offers predictive analytics capabilities, enabling better decision-making and improving operational efficiencies. As the smart meter market evolves, software solutions continue to drive innovation, supporting the shift towards smarter and more sustainable energy systems.
Advanced Metering Infrastructure (AMI) plays a pivotal role in the smart meter market, revolutionizing the way utilities and consumers interact with energy data. By integrating smart meters with communication networks and data management systems, AMI allows for real-time monitoring and management of energy usage. This enhanced capability not only improves the accuracy of billing but also empowers consumers with insights to optimize their energy consumption. Additionally, AMI facilitates demand response programs and contributes to more efficient energy distribution, paving the way for smarter and more sustainable energy grids.

The Asia-Pacific (APAC) region is emerging as a critical market for smart meters, driven by rapid urbanization and increasing energy demands. Governments in APAC countries are heavily investing in smart grid technologies to enhance energy efficiency, improve grid reliability, and reduce carbon emissions. Countries like China, Japan, and India are at the forefront of this transformation, with substantial rollouts of smart meters as part of their broader energy management strategies. The adoption of smart meters in the APAC region is also supported by favorable regulatory environments and significant infrastructural developments.
